Output 910a6f56b7331c3d40b8ecb56c2d4ffb20d5c95d81f5af6db41021e293f666bf:0

value
5423325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670ad8950e2c9d61a084a4e8ad6fdccb564bc986 OP_EQUAL
address
MHHzpnQeYWUL4vHSi9zUnAX9yhFN2F3Zww
transaction
910a6f56b7331c3d40b8ecb56c2d4ffb20d5c95d81f5af6db41021e293f666bf
spent
true